HB Tamrakar,New York, USA –Renowned author and scholar Dr. Rajan Thapaliya recently had the rare honor of meeting Jim Dale, a living legend whose voice has captivated millions across the globe. The moment, described by Dr. Thapaliya as “nothing short of magical,” was more than just a meeting—it was a celebration of artistic legacy, storytelling brilliance, and timeless inspiration.
Jim Dale, best known for his Oscar-nominated performances, two-time Grammy-winning narration of the Harry Potter series, and Tony Award-winning Broadway career, represents a towering figure in the world of performance art. His legendary narration brought the wizarding world to life for countless fans, his voice becoming synonymous with the magic of J.K. Rowling’s creation.
